Tme wood venier on my 87 300E has been cooked by the New Mexico sun and has cracked and chipped. Is it possible to replace this lower section of the console? If so where can I get one?

By "the lower section of the console", do you mean the wood part around the wood part surrounding the shift lever, with all the power window buttons and the radio fader? This section removes easily, as shown in the "DIY" tab above, w124 stereo removal. If PartsShop can't get it for you, then you might try this thread to see about your options Cracked center wood 400e
